Challenges of Recovering at Home

Recovering at home after a hospital stay can present a variety of challenges that impact the overall healing process. One of the primary concerns for patients is the issue of mobility. Many individuals experience physical limitations due to their health status, which can result in a sense of isolation and frustration. Limited mobility can hinder daily activities, such as bathing, dressing, and even moving around the house. Ensuring that the home environment is conducive to recovery, with modifications such as grab bars and clear pathways, becomes essential to facilitate independence.

Pain management also remains a critical challenge. Patients discharged from the hospital may still experience significant pain or discomfort related to their medical condition. Managing this pain effectively requires coordination with healthcare providers to adjust medications and therapies, ensuring that patients have the right information and resources at their disposal. Failing to manage pain adequately can lead to complications, further prolonging the recovery process and decreasing the patient’s quality of life.

Safety within the home is another paramount concern. As patients transition from the more controlled hospital setting to the often chaotic home environment, risks such as falls or medication errors increase. Ensuring that the home is safe and accommodating will require planning, such as removing obstacles and organizing medical supplies in a manner that is easily accessible. Additionally, emotional challenges accompany the physical aspects of recovery. Patients often experience feelings of anxiety, loneliness, or depression when moving back to their home environment. The shift from the hospital—where support is readily available—to home can exacerbate these feelings.

Addressing these challenges thoughtfully and proactively is crucial for a successful recovery at home. Creating a supportive environment and having a robust care plan can significantly improve health outcomes and enhance the patient’s recovery experience.

Role of Family Caregivers in Recovery

Family caregivers play a fundamental role in the recovery process of patients returning home after a hospital stay. Their presence not only fosters a nurturing environment but also provides vital emotional support. Patients often experience a range of emotions, from anxiety to frustration, during their recovery. Family members can help mitigate these feelings by being actively engaged, listening to their concerns, and reinforcing positive attitudes toward healing.

Moreover, caregivers assist in managing daily tasks that the recovering individual might find challenging. This support can encompass a variety of activities, including preparing meals, administering medications, and facilitating mobility within the home. By taking on these responsibilities, family caregivers ensure that the patient can focus on their recovery without feeling overwhelmed by household duties. This assistance is critical, as it contributes to a smoother transition from hospital to home, promoting stability and a sense of normalcy.

It is important for family caregivers to also educate themselves about the patient’s specific health conditions and the required post-hospital care. Familiarizing oneself with the recovery process can empower caregivers to effectively navigate any challenges that arise during this period. Communication among family members is vital; discussing any concerns or changes in the patient’s condition can lead to timely interventions and adjustments in care strategies.

To effectively support their loved ones, family caregivers should consider prioritizing self-care. Caring for another can be taxing both physically and emotionally, and taking breaks, seeking external support, and managing stress levels is essential. By doing so, caregivers can sustain their ability to offer consistent support throughout the recovery period, ultimately contributing to improved health outcomes for the patient.

Preparing Your Home for Recovery

Transitioning from a hospital environment to home can be a significant change, especially for individuals requiring post-hospital recovery. Creating a supportive environment is crucial to facilitate healing and ensure a smooth recuperation process. Here are some practical tips to prepare your home for recovery.

The first step is to assess the space where the recovering individual will spend most of their time. This area should be organized to accommodate any medical equipment that may be necessary, such as a wheelchair, crutches, or an oxygen tank. Ensure that there is sufficient space for movement around the equipment to prevent accidents.

Safety is another paramount concern. Install grab bars in the bathroom and near stairs, and remove any tripping hazards like loose rugs or clutter that could obstruct pathways. Consider repositioning furniture to provide clear access points, especially if mobility is compromised. Additionally, it may be wise to use non-slip mats in bathrooms and kitchens to enhance stability.

Creating a comfortable space for relaxation is equally important during recovery. Keep essential items, such as medications, water, and reading materials, within easy reach. Use extra pillows to provide support and ensure that the seating arrangement is comfortable, allowing for long periods of rest. Adjust lighting to be soft yet sufficient, as harsh lighting can be distressing during recovery.

Finally, maintaining cleanliness in the home is vital for preventing infections. Regularly sanitize commonly touched surfaces and ensure that the refrigerator is well-stocked with nutritious foods that promote healing. By following these steps, you can create an environment conducive to recovery, allowing the individual to focus on getting better in the comfort of their own home.
